Raikkonen: Viewing F1 as a hobby makes it more fun

Kimi Raikkonen says his move to Alfa Romeo has sparked increased enjoyment of Formula 1 as he has been able to view it as a hobby. The 39-year-old Finn was replaced at Ferrari by its latest prodigy Charles Leclerc for the 2019 season, with Raikkonen moving in the opposite direction to link back up with the rebranded Sauber squad he made his F1 debut with back in 2001. Asked how he keeps himself motivated to continue on in F1, Raikkonen replied: “I don’t know really. I don’t have any special things that I try to motivate myself. “It’s become more of a hobby for me lately than anything else and probably that’s why it’s more fun again, so I always try to do the best that I can....
